Sponsor's own description

Technically successful laser crossectomy will reduce the risk of reflux recurrence at the sapheno-femoral junction without increasing the risk of endovenous heat-induced thrombosis, which may positively impact the likelihood of ultrasound- or clinical-recurrence of varicose veins. Similar technical efficacy is expected for laser crossectomy at 1940 nm and 1470 nm. A possible advantage of the 1940 nm wavelength in terms of postoperative pain intensity and the risk of adverse events cannot be ruled out.
